What is Window Refurbishment?


Window refurbishment includes the restoration, repair, or updating of existing windows. Unlike window replacement, which entails getting rid of old windows completely and installing new ones, refurbishment focuses on maintaining the original frames and glass, often resulting in significant expense savings while maintaining the character of a structure.

The Window Refurbishment Process

Window refurbishment usually occurs in numerous phases, as described below:

  1. Assessment and Inspection:

    • Condition Analysis: Inspect windows for rot, fractures, or structural problems.
    • Energy Efficiency Check: Evaluate insulation and sealing efficiency.
  2. Cleaning up and Preparation:

    • Surface Cleaning: Remove dirt, paint, and old sealant.
    • Repair Work: Address any structural damage, such as rot or decay.
  3. Updating Components:

    • Sealing Gaps: Improve weatherization by using brand-new seals or caulk.
    • Glass Replacement: Upgrade to double or triple glazing for much better insulation.
  4. Ending up Touches:

    • Painting and Staining: Restore or change the exterior surface for defense and aesthetic appeals.
    • Hardware Replacement: Update locks, manages, and hinges for enhanced performance.
  5. Final Inspection:

    • Ensure all reconditioned elements are functioning properly and effectively.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How long does window refurbishment take?

The period can differ depending on the number of windows and the level of the work needed. On average, it can take anywhere from a couple of days to numerous weeks.

2. Can all kinds of windows be refurbished?

A lot of window types can be reconditioned, consisting of wood, aluminum, and vinyl windows. However, the methods might vary.

3. Is refurbishment eco-friendly?

Yes, reconditioning windows is a sustainable practice as it minimizes waste and conserves resources by extending the lifespan of existing products.

4. How can I inform if my windows require refurbishment?

Signs consist of draftiness, condensation in between the panes, peeling paint, and noticeable damage like rot or fractures.

5. Should I attempt refurbishment myself?

While small repair work can be carried out by homeowners, it's typically best to hire experts for substantial work or if you lack experience, especially with structural modifications.
